So first job was to sort out the exhaust . It seemed very loud and was popping and banging . Turned out the manifold was not quite seated properly and one of the central exhaust clamps was slightly loose . So removal of the rusted exhaust manifold studs and replacement with new stainless steel ones with copper nuts was called for , plus whilst I was there a good machine polish of the header . Looks and sounds much better now . Removed the front panels and air box and checked the valve clearances , all OK , fitted new Iridium Spark plugs and a K&N Air filter . Wired in the AF-XIED unit and did a full Adaptions re-set with the GS-911 . Next job , remove the swinging arm and check the bearings and seals .....then a few hours out riding after lunch ;-)

Nearly finished sorting out the XCountry . All mechanical items checked with various bearings and seals renewed along with a new modified later type clutch cover . New HyperPro rear shock , front forks rebuilt , chain and sprockets and tyres all replaced . Fitted a new seat and had a lot of the parts satin black powder coated . Brakes fully stripped and rebuilt with new seals . Fitted some new bling - heated grips , SATNAV mount , LED headlamp upgrade along with LED indicators , various guards , newer type mirrors , fender extender .
